Отличная идея — создать собственный NAS из старого компьютера или специально подобранных комплектующих. Это не только полезно, но и позволяет вам полностью контролировать свои данные. TrueNAS — мощная, надежная платформа с открытым исходным кодом — часто используется в качестве операционной системы для таких домашних серверов.
По сути, процесс установки не так сложен, как кажется: вам нужно просто записать образ системы на флешку, загрузиться с нее и следовать подсказкам мастера установки. Тем не менее, для того, чтобы установка прошла успешно, необходимо учитывать несколько важных моментов заранее.
В этой статье мы разберем, как установить TrueNAS на ваш будущий сетевой накопитель шаг за шагом. Мы рассмотрим подготовку загрузочного носителя, настройки BIOS и то, на что следует обратить внимание при установке. Вы будете готовы запустить свой персональный облачный сервер в ближайшее время.
↑ Что такое TrueNAS
Таким образом, NAS. Подробный обзор устройств можно найти в статье сайта под названием «Что такое хранилище NAS». Компании, такие как Synology, Western Digital и D-Link, предлагают готовые устройства NAS. В них включена операционная система NAS. с множеством предложений от производителей. Однако мы можем собрать NAS самостоятельно. В статье «NAS своими руками» подробно описано, как это сделать. И если мы соберём NAS своими руками, как и в случае с ПК, нам нужно самим заниматься вопросом операционной системы, которая будет управлять устройством.
Операционная система NAS — это любая десктопная система, включая Windows или Linux. Однако предпочтительнее использовать специализированные для NAS. Они быстродействующи и просты в использовании, и их системные процессы не загружают системные ресурсы NAS. Тем не менее, в первую очередь эти специализированные операционные системы ориентированы на работу NAS:
- Нативно предусматривают необходимые настройки, функции и технологии для базового функционирования NAS;
- Работают с современными быстрыми файловыми системами типа ZFS, Btrfs, Ext4, которым тормознутая NTFS Windows и в подмётки не годится.
Таким образом, TrueNAS является одной из лучших операционных систем NAS. Совершенно бесплатная, производительная, имеет современный интерфейс и удобные настройки по сравнению с другими системами. Он представляет собой интерфейс сложной программы или базовой прошивки. На главном экране будут отображаться виджеты системной информации и использования ресурсов NAS. Другие функции операционной системы находятся в разделах ее интерфейса.

TrueNAS — это разработка с открытым исходным кодом. Основывается на FreeBSD. Он был известен как FreeNAS. Это работа американской компании iXsystems. Кроме того, это динамичный проект, который поддерживается и обновляется, а также имеет сообщество, поддержку, форумы и другие элементы.
Бесплатные редакции TrueNAS включают Core, Enterprise и Scale. iXsystems заявляет, что такие известные компании, как NBC, Disney, Fox и Nike, являются клиентами и пользователями TrueNAS. Несмотря на это, друзья, само космическое агентство США NASA использует данные хранилища на базе TrueNAS, которые являются чрезвычайно важными для развития человечества.
TrueNAS использует самые передовые файловые системы ZFS. Предполагает программный RAID для хранилищ с конфигурациями RAID 0 и RAID 1. Кроме того, он предлагает отказоустойчивые конфигурации RAID-Z и RAID-Z2, улучшенные аналоги конфигураций RAID 5 и RAID 6, которые не встречаются в других технологиях реализации RAID.
TrueNAS изначально поддерживает работу технологии Samba (SMB), которая позволяет взаимодействовать между Unix-системами, в том числе TrueNAS, и Windows, на которой основаны наши ПК и ноутбуки. Кроме того, мы будем использовать NAS-хранилище в качестве сетевого диска. Кроме того, локальные диски не отличаются особо.

↑ TrueNAS: системные требования
Такие системные условия необходимы для TrueNAS:
- 64-битный процессор Intel или AMD (важно: ARM не поддерживается);
- 16 Гб оперативной памяти (но можно 8 Гб или даже 4 Гб);
- Как минимум один жёсткий диск для хранилища (но желательно как минимум два диска для создания отказоустойчивого RAID 1);
- Отдельный жёсткий диск для установки самой TrueNAS как минимум на 16 Гб.
Друзья, SSD лучше всего подходит для дисков TrueNAS. Он не требует высокого качества или производительности. Самый дешевый SSD SATA доступен. Кроме того, не обязательно иметь большой объем; если есть в наличии, можно приобрести 60/64 Гб или даже 32 Гб.
Итак, друзья, давайте скачаем и настроим TrueNAS.
↑ Как скачать TrueNAS
TrueNAS устанавливается, как и десктопные операционные системы, с установочного носителя. Для его создания необходимо скачать установочный ISO TrueNAS на сайте проекта операционной системы. Далее этот ISO мы записываем на флешку любой программой, которая предназначена для этих задач. Можем создать универсальную загрузочную флешку для Legacy и UEFI средствами Windows. А можем использовать программы Rufus, WinUSB, AIO Boot Creator, Ventoy. При их использовании не забываем правильно выбрать режим флешки — Legacy или UEFI. Если компьютер поддерживает UEFI, предпочтительно использовать его.
Если вы следуете пошаговой инструкции, установка TrueNAS на NAS своими руками проста и понятна. TrueNAS обеспечивает надежное хранилище для домашнего сервера, файлов и резервных копий, используя обычный компьютер или сборку из доступных компонентов. Система подходит как для новичков, так и для опытных пользователей, и она бесплатна и стабильная. Важно правильно подготовить оборудование, записать образ на флешку и быстро завершить установку. Результат — безопасное, гибкое и удобное хранилище, которое работает у вас дома и под вашим контролем.
↑ Как установить TrueNAS
Чтобы установить любую операционную систему на NAS-устройство, сначала необходимо подключить клавиатуру и монитор. Затем следуйте процедуре, аналогичной процедуре установки операционной системы на компьютере:
- подключаем установочную флешку,
- включаем NAS,
- либо запускаем Boot-меню BIOS и указываем эту флешку,
- либо входим в BIOS и выставляем приоритет загрузки с флешки.
Помните, что режим BIOS должен быть UEFI или традиционным. Несомненно, современный UEFI предпочтительнее, если ваш компьютер поддерживает UEFI. Мы должны выбрать режим BIOS UEFI или традиционный при установке TrueNAS. До установки операционной системы этот режим должен быть настроен в BIOS.
На экране появится процесс установки TrueNAS. Друзья, мы используем только клавиши в этом консольном процессе. У нас нет графического интерфейса и мыши. Стандартно стрелки навигации или клавиши Tab используются для переключения между пунктами меню и вариантами выбора. Для подтверждения выбора обычно используется клавиша Enter. В некоторых ситуациях клавиша пробела используется для выбора.
На начальном этапе процесса установки вы можете запустить установку TrueNAS, нажав Enter в первом пункте меню.

Выбираем «Install/Upgrade».

Мы узнали, что установка TrueNAS не рекомендуется, если оперативная память менее 8 Гб. Кроме того, он спрашивает, продолжать ли установку. Мы отвечаем «Да». При меньшем объеме оперативной памяти TrueNAS будет работать эффективно.

Теперь мы можем увидеть диалоговое окно выбора дисков, где мы должны установить TrueNAS. Мы указываем отдельный диск, который был подготовлен для операционной системы. Мы должны ориентироваться на размеры. Это диск на 16 Гб в нашем случае. Мы можем отметить его клавишей пробела.

Предупреждение о стирании данных на диске, на котором будет установлена операционная система.

Это этап создания администраторской учётной записи, который позволит управлять NAS удаленно. Мы, друзья, обычно называемся root. Это нечто вроде учётной записи администратора Windows в UNIX-системах. Мы также должны создать и подтвердить пароль.
Мы можем выбрать режим BIOS:
- UEFI – вариант «Boot via UEFI»,
- Legacy – вариант «Boot via BI0S».
Внедрение TrueNAS завершено.
Мы должны перезагрузить компьютер и извлечь установочный носитель. Выберите «Восстановление системы».

Наша TrueNAS запустится после перезагрузки. Мы сможем увидеть консольный вариант основных функций NAS-устройства, таких как настройка сети, сброс настроек в дефолт, перезагрузка и выключение. Нам пока ничего из этого не нужно, потому что сеть в большинстве случаев настроится автоматически. Мы просто нуждаемся в IP-адресе нашего NAS в локальной сети. Внизу показано.

Мы продолжим подключаться к TrueNAS удаленно с Windows-компьютера с помощью этого IP-адпеса. Настроим операционную систему и само NAS-хранилище с помощью стандартного GUI. Таким образом, работа с NAS-устройством завершена. Вы можете отключить клавиатуру и монитор, поскольку они более не нужны. Мы переходим к работе на Windows.
↑ Как удалённо подключиться к TrueNAS
Мы запускаем браузер на Windows-кoмпьютере. В нем мы и будем управлять TrueNAS удалённо с помощью веб-панели. В адресной строке необходимо ввести IP-адрес, указанный на консольном экране TrueNAS. Просто жмем Enter. После авторизации вводим:
- Логин – root,
- Пароль – тот, что задали на этапе установки TrueNAS.

↑ TrueNAS: общие настройки
После входа в веб-панель удаленного управления TrueNAS начнем знакомиться с интерфейсом системы. Устанавливаем необходимый нам язык, регион и другие важные параметры локализации, перейдя в настройки «Система → Общие». Нажмите «Сохранить».

Мы также можем изменить дизайн TrueNAS. Нажимаем значок шестерёнки справа и выбираем «Предпочтения».

Выберите тему, которая вам нравится. Для TrueNAS доступны восемь готовых стильных современных тем. Кроме того, дает возможность настроить свое. Жмем «Обновить предпочтения».

Из основного это все. Вы можете найти дополнительные настройки в разделе общих. В частности, найдите «Обновление» и обновите TrueNAS.
↑ TrueNAS: как создать NAS-хранилище
Давайте перейдем к самому важному компоненту настройки TrueNAS — созданию NAS-хранилища. Выберите «Хранилище → Диски». В этом разделе показаны все жёсткие диски NAS-устройств. Первым в нашем случае является загрузочный диск на 16 Гб, на котором установлена и работает TrueNAS. Он не может быть тронут. Мы планируем построить NAS-хранилище на основе двух дополнительных жёстких дисков. Мы планируем построить это хранилище на основе программного RAID 1, то есть массива-зеркала, который обеспечивает базовую отказоустойчивость.

Перейдите в раздел «Пулы» и выберите «Хранилище → Пулы». Затем нажмите «Добавить».

Выберите «Создать пyл».

Придумываем на латинице имя пулу. В блоке «Доступные диски» отмечаем галочками диски, которые мы ставим в пул для создания RAID. Жмём кнопку-стрелочку. Если диски в блоке «Доступные диски» не отображаются, ставим ниже блока галочку опции «Show disks with non-unique serial numbers».

Диски будут перемещены в блок VDev Data. Из выпадающего списка выберите конфигyрацию RAID для них. В нашем случае это называется «Зеркало». Выберите «Создать». После этого мы подтверждаем. И выбираем «Создать пул».

↑ TrueNAS: как создать общую папку NAS
Теперь мы видим пул дисков, созданный на основе NAS-хранилища, когда переходим в меню «Хранилище → Пулы». Однако, чтобы работать с хранилищами по сети, мы должны создать одну или несколько общих папок для данных внутри каждого из этих хранилищ. Это можно сделать, нажав кнопку «Добавить набор данных» в меню хранилища.

Мы должны придумать латинское имя для всей папки. Мы указываем тип ресурса «SMB», который является сокращенным названием технологии Samba, которая отвечает за возможность работы NAS на базе Unix в среде Windows. Нажмите «Отправить».

Теперь, когда мы переходим от «Хранилище» к «Пулы», мы уже создали хранилище и общую папку, которую мы сможем использовать в среде Windows.

Мы переходим по пути «Общий доступ → Ресурсы Windows (SMB), чтобы она стала доступной в среде Windows». Выберите «Добавить».

Мы находим нашу общую папку и нажимаем «Отправить».

В связи с тем, что Samba отключена по умолчанию, TrueNAS предложит нам запyстить его. Выберите «Включить службу».

↑ TrueNAS: создание пользователя NAS
И ещё одна формальность, друзья – создание пользователя NAS. На этапе установки TrueNAS мы создавали пользователя-администратора для управления операционной системой. Но нам ещё нужно создать пользователя для пользования NAS-устройством. Ведь NAS – это сетевое хранилище общего пользования, и у него может быть много пользователей. Это могут быть не только люди, но также различные сетевые устройства (IP-камеры, медиасерверы и т.п.) и различные технологии или протоколы (FTP, WebDAV и т.п.). У каждого пользователя могут быть разные права доступа к данным – права на чтение, запись, выполнение файлов запуска. И каждый из пользователей может быть ограничен в доступе только к определённым папкам, но не всем. Ограничен персонально или на основе принадлежности к какой-то группе.
Когда мы освоим возможности TrueNAS, мы сократим все эти сложности. Пока мы работаем над фундаментом. Мы должны пройти через «Учётные записи → Пользователи». В этом месте мы видим уже существующего пользователя-администратора root, то есть нас самих, которые управляем TrueNAS. Добавьте еще одного пользователя. Выберите «Добавить».

Мы придумываем имя пользователя и подтверждаем пароль.

При необходимости мы можем быстро создать группы для этого пользователя. Для этого нужно выставить права на использование ресурсов NAS, поставив галочки на три типа прав: чтение, запись и исполнение файлов, а затем нажать «Отправить».

Все готово, пользователь NAS создан. Мы создаем дополнительных пользователей NAS, если это необходимо. Кроме того, мы ограничиваем их права, если это необходимо.

Как вы можете видеть, собрать и настроить свой NAS на TrueNAS — вполне реальная задача. Даже если вы не опытный системный администратор, вы не должны бояться процесса удаления. Важно четко следовать инструкциям и внимательно выбирать комплектующие.
Теперь ваши файлы будут в порядке и под надежной защитой благодаря использованию готового сервера. Вы получите больше, чем просто сетевое хранилище, а также полную платформу для резервного копирования, развертывания домашних сервисов и хранения данных.
Самое ценное в этом проекте — полный контроль над своими данными, поскольку вы можете выбирать «железо» и настраивать систему под свои нужды, не завися от готовых решений. Такой NAS будет служить вам долгое время, развиваясь в соответствии с вашими потребностями.








